Transaction 02d3143f33ff2514ebd5bf5caa84ccb024fbc10caef29eba67033aa9871afe42

1 Input
1 Outputs
  • 02d3143f33ff2514ebd5bf5caa84ccb024fbc10caef29eba67033aa9871afe42:0
  • value  218777
    address  34hmXJK4A6sGyHY27u2yCW7JVQHAoiZV5h